WebAcrylic gesso is formulated to have an “open” surface to accept the paint layer, but acrylic paint has a “closed” surface to protect the paint film from stains, grime and other pollutants. The closed surface is nonabsorbent and provides a very poor bond for oil paints. WebMay 20, 2024 · 4. Liquitex Professional White Gesso. WebNov 11, 2009 · NEVER use acrylic gesso or primer over oil paint, unless a cracked or peeled painting is what you’re after.
